zetec turbo boost problem
as in title... it drives fine but as soon as it comes on boost it missfires, pops and bangs sometimes it boosts fine. ive changed the plugs then checked them after a drive and one of them goes a bit white on the end which i beleive is due to running lean and the rest are wet. anyone know what it could be?
#3
just put petrol in the car and its boosting fine it seems like it starts to have this problem when it has 1/4 tank or less in... anyone know what it could be? maybe a fuel pump mounted wrong?

which plugs and leads you running ?
try running the car on some rs focus plugs as they run slightly cooler than std zetec ones
would check leads and coil pack to for faults.
the car would benfit from running on super unleaded to cut the risk of melting something.
As for it doing it at half tank would check the pressure on the fuel pump and fuel reg as it could be just a earthing problem or the pump not man enough for the job
would also check to see if it is running right and have the set up checked

Or could be the usual Walbro 255 problem when used to replace standard Ford intank pump. Has quite a high pickup as it has a built in filter. Well know issue for example on FRS - either never run less than 1/4 tank or, standard pump to external swirl pot or, use a 'blue' or 'green' top pump.
